#6abfa8 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#6abfa8 is composed of 41.6% red, 74.9% green and 65.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 44.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 12% yellow and 25.1% black. It has a hue angle of 163.8 degrees, a saturation of 39.9% and a lightness of 58.2%. #6abfa8 color hex could be obtained by blending #d4ffff with #007f51. Closest websafe color is: #66cc99.

Shades and Tints of #6abfa8

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010202 is the darkest color, while #f3faf8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#6abfa8

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#939695 is the less saturated color, while #31f8c2 is the most saturated one.
